The Chaplain Corps partners with non-profit organizations to bring certified therapy dogs directly to offices around Schriever SFB. This unique program is designed to promote wellness, relieve mission stress, and bring a little extra joy to the workplace.

Hey , we listened!

The traffic light at Curtis Road and Irwin Drive is scheduled to be removed around 9 a.m. on Tuesday, August 25.

The intersection will be returning to its original configuration to improve safety and optimize traffic flow. Please exercise caution, reduce your speed when approaching the intersection, and watch for updated signage as drivers adjust to the new pattern.

We received feedback regarding the traffic light's impact on commuters entering and exiting through the Irwin Gate, as well as concerns regarding outbound traffic in the morning. SBD 41 has been monitoring the traffic flow situation throughout the Enoch Gate construction and continues to work with on-base subject-matter experts and our partners at El Paso County to find effective solutions where needed.

On 22 August 2026, at approximately 1:15 p.m., there was an aircraft incident on Schriever SFB involving a small civilian aircraft associated with the Rocky Mountain Flight Training Center. The aircraft landed south of base housing, after declaring an in-flight emergency due to an engine failure.

There were two individuals on board the aircraft with no injuries reported.

Schriever SFB emergency responders are on the scene.

The 3rd Space Operations Squadron (3 SOPS) under Combat Forces Command’s Mission Delta 9 gave a presentation on the Squadron’s involvement in VICTUS HAZE. VICTUS HAZE is a multi-launch, multi-vehicle mission designed to demonstrate the Nation’s capability to rapidly acquire, launch, and operate space vehicles on operationally relevant timelines in response to urgent on-orbit threats, a function crucial to today’s modern threat environment in space.

3 SOPS led the planning for a complex on-orbit mission conducted post-launch. Their meticulous coordination with commercial partners was vital in executing a Notice-to-Launch order, resulting in a successful launch 16 hours after notification, beating an established 24-hour goal by eight hours. This proves the ability of the United States Space Force to conduct advanced Space Domain Awareness operations, successfully tracking and characterizing passive and actively maneuvering spacecraft during the operation. It also validated critical inspection capabilities. Missions like VICTUS HAZE prove the U.S. Space Force remains ready to achieve space control when called upon at a moment’s notice.
